1When Israel came out of Egypt, the children of Jacob from a people whose language was strange to them;
1When Israel went out of Egypt, the house of Jacob from a people of strange language;
1In the going out of Israel from Egypt, The house of Jacob from a strange people,
2Judah became his holy place, and Israel his kingdom.
2Judah was his sanctuary, and Israel his dominion.
2Judah became His sanctuary, Israel his dominion.
3The sea saw it, and went in flight; Jordan was turned back.
3The sea saw it, and fled: Jordan was driven back.
3The sea hath seen, and fleeth, The Jordan turneth backward.
4The mountains were jumping like goats, and the little hills like lambs.
4The mountains skipped like rams, and the little hills like lambs.
4The mountains have skipped as rams, Heights as sons of a flock.
5What was wrong with you, O sea, that you went in flight? O Jordan, that you were turned back?
5What ailed thee, O thou sea, that thou fleddest? thou Jordan, that thou wast driven back?
5What--to thee, O sea, that thou fleest? O Jordan, thou turnest back!
6You mountains, why were you jumping like goats, and you little hills like lambs?
6Ye mountains, that ye skipped like rams; and ye little hills, like lambs?
6O mountains, ye skip as rams! O heights, as sons of a flock!
